diff options
author | LaMont Jones | 2007-07-18 01:47:33 +0200 |
---|---|---|
committer | Karel Zak | 2007-07-25 18:56:38 +0200 |
commit | 503e4f0c5b49fa556d4b0c70311d88ac8cc6df9a (patch) | |
tree | 2088f7936f96ed57eab030438616290ba01e8f3f /login-utils/agetty.c | |
parent | docs: add rdev(8) between deprecated utils (diff) | |
download | kernel-qcow2-util-linux-503e4f0c5b49fa556d4b0c70311d88ac8cc6df9a.tar.gz kernel-qcow2-util-linux-503e4f0c5b49fa556d4b0c70311d88ac8cc6df9a.tar.xz kernel-qcow2-util-linux-503e4f0c5b49fa556d4b0c70311d88ac8cc6df9a.zip |
agetty: fix short malloc in initstring handling
Signed-off-by: LaMont Jones <lamont@mmjgroup.com>
Diffstat (limited to 'login-utils/agetty.c')
-rw-r--r-- | login-utils/agetty.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/login-utils/agetty.c b/login-utils/agetty.c index d5359d2c4..ff27b70ba 100644 --- a/login-utils/agetty.c +++ b/login-utils/agetty.c @@ -418,7 +418,7 @@ parse_args(argc, argv, op) op->eightbits = 1; break; case 'I': - if (!(op->initstring = malloc(strlen(optarg)))) { + if (!(op->initstring = malloc(strlen(optarg)+1))) { error(_("can't malloc initstring")); break; } |